Transaction 35e8ed822492c1b0cfb844795c6151142e8f3d53d63389ccfc42c7bd23f11715
1 Input
1 Output
-
35e8ed822492c1b0cfb844795c6151142e8f3d53d63389ccfc42c7bd23f11715:0
- value
- 70796
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e14109b53135f57300bfe0850b51cdc885a6a3c5 OP_EQUAL
- address
- 3NE3sctVkstnFPjWvJyukgiK4otza5uxnu